S. Korea’s ICT exports up 20.6% in May on yr primarily on chips

South Korea’s exports of information and communications technology (ICT) products kept up double-digit growth for the 18th straight month in May led entirely by semiconductors.

According to data released by the Ministry of Science and ICT, the country’s outbound shipments of ICT products reached $18.57 billion in May, up 20.6 percent from a year ago. The monthly tally has kept up growth in double digits since December 2016.

The surplus in ICT trade hit $9.84 billion in May as imports totaled $8.73 billion.

Memory chips took up the bulk of $10.94 billion, up 43.5 percent on year. Exports of mobile phones reversed from a losing streak and gained 4.5 percent on year to $1.41 billion.

Shipments of computers and related equipment jumped 28.6 percent to $950 million last month on brisk sales of solid state drives (SSDs) reaching $490 million, up 12.5 percent from a year earlier.

By region, exports to China expanded 32.7 percent to hit the record high of $10.4 billion in May. Shipments to the U.S. and Europe also rose to $1.78 billion and $1.01 billion, up 32.2 percent and 28.4 percent, respectively. Exports to Vietnam fell by 13 percent to $1.91 billion due to a drop in sales of display panels and mobile phones.
